Allen Institute’s big new bet: $400M effort aims to go from mapping the brain to treating disease

The Allen Institute is launching a $400 million initiative, the Brain Health Accelerator, to develop gene therapies for neurodegenerative diseases including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, Huntington’s, and ALS. It marks the first time the Seattle research organization, founded by Paul Allen in 2003, has made treating disease its goal. Read More

Allen Institute for AI launches big computing cluster for $152M project backed by Nvidia and NSF

Ai2 says it has started using a new Nvidia-powered computing system funded through a $152 million NSF and Nvidia project to build open AI models for scientific research. The milestone comes as the Seattle nonprofit works to regain its footing after losing key researchers to Microsoft. Read More

Allen Institute for AI rivals Google, Meta and OpenAI with open-source AI vision model

Ai2 unveiled Molmo 2, a new open-source AI model that can analyze video with precision — tracking objects, counting events, and pinpointing exactly where and when things happen in a clip. The advanced vision system offers an open alternative to closed video models from Google, OpenAI, and others. Read More
